Default which epi spring is best?

i had my dealer put an epi clutch kit in my sp700. he put in the purple spring and i couldn't even back up without the override button pushed. is this normal? the engagement seemed too high for slow trail riding so i told him to put in the yellow spring but instead he changed something else, secondary maybe? anyway, what do you guys suggest? It's brand new and i never drove it with the stock clutching so i don't know how different it is. thanks!

Default which epi spring is best?

EPI red spring is a good one to use.It is the same as a Polaris white.This is the next one up from stock. Changing primary spring will give a higher engagement, giving you a stronger take off. Yes you will have to use the reverse button if the primary spring is changed. You can bipass the button if you dont like using it.

Default which epi spring is best?

Im not sure about the yellow. All i know is that the red is a little higher engagement than stock. Before my Trailblazer was modded i could not pull the wheels up untill i put the red spring in and it made a huge difference. Now that it has mods i have an HPD clutch kit. Either way i had to use the button.
